Shaurya Yatra marks ABVP foundation day in Gorakhpur
Gorakhpur: To commemorate the 77th foundation day of
(ABVP), the Gorakhpur city unit organised a Chhatra Shakti Shaurya Yatra and a symposium at Saraswati Shishu Mandir, Surajkund on Wednesday.

Over 1,000 students participated in the grand procession, while around 1,500 students attended the symposium.
The yatra was flagged off from Saraswati Shishu Mandir in Pakkibagh and passed through Gangez Tiraha and Dharamshala before culminating back at the school premises. Senior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h (RSS) leader and Goraksh Prant Sanghchalak Mahendra Agrawal said that those who once dismissed ABVP are now surprised by its growth and impact.
"The Parishad is actively turning Swami Vivekananda's vision of a 'Young India' into reality by igniting youth consciousness not just in universities but also in villages, tribal regions, and border areas," he added.
ABVP national secretary Ankit Shukla emphasized, " ABVP is more than just a student body. It is a movement that views education as the foundation of nation-building. ABVP doesn't just produce degree holders; it nurtures responsible, socially aware citizens."
Highlighting the organization's contributions during national crises like the Covid-19 pandemic, Shukla said ABVP workers were always at the forefront.
Several regional leaders and volunteers including Shrirang Narayan Pandey, Puneet Agrawal, Rajvardhan, Shubham Govind Rao, and Kishan Mishra were also present.
